The Global AC Electric Motor in Oil & Gas Market is forecasted to grow significantly, with a projected USD 14.64 billion in 2023 at a CAGR of 6.90% and expected to reach a staggering USD 23.45 billion by 2030.

Market Segmentation & Coverage:
This research report categorizes the Global AC Electric Motor in Oil & Gas Market in order to forecast the revenues and analyze trends in each of following sub-markets:
Based on Product Type, market is studied across Induction Motor and Synchronous Motor. The Synchronous Motor commanded largest market share of 73.28% in 2022, followed by Induction Motor.
Based on Voltage, market is studied across 1-6.6 kV Motor, <1 kV Motor, and >6.6 kV Motor. The 1-6.6 kV Motor commanded largest market share of 45.33% in 2022, followed by >6.6 kV Motor.
Based on Output Power (HP), market is studied across <1 HP Motor and >1 HP Motor. The >1 HP Motor is projected to witness significant market share during forecast period.
Based on Mode of Operation, market is studied across Offshore and Onshore. The Offshore commanded largest market share of 53.61% in 2022, followed by Onshore.
